NIA files chargesheet against two in Baramulla arms seizure case

The National Investigation Agency (NIA) filed charges against two alleged Hizb-ul-Mujahideen (HM) members in Jammu. Mubashir Maqbool Mir and driver Waheed ul-Zahoor were apprehended after explosives and weapons were discovered in their vehicle at a Baramulla checkpoint on June 30. Waheed's attempted escape and subsequent confession led investigators to Mir. Both are accused of collaborating with HM operatives in Pakistan.Original Article
